Transaction 61415f1b9f2613c5806cfa690816e21ef3aca6f9da3472f0972b92bd4f29b7e0
2 Input
1 Outputs
- 61415f1b9f2613c5806cfa690816e21ef3aca6f9da3472f0972b92bd4f29b7e0:0
value 54145192
address 3QEDfvhy6yXc7mV2qgZVxQsSoF3KL1oUVg